BoxOffice Report: April 30th, 2006

Posted by: Shawn
It's a weekend of the newcomers. Three of this week's new releases have taken the top spots on the chart today. Robin William's road trip comedy "RV" came in at #1 showing that William's still has what it takes to steal the show. Second on the list is the 9/11 tragic drama "United 93" proving that despite it's controversial topic, there were a great number of people ready to see a film about one of this decade's greatest tragedies. But there were also a great number of people ready to see a movie about bouncing gymnast girls with "Stick It" coming in at a close third. Last week's "Silent Hill" remains on the chart, but moved down 3 spots since last weekend when it debuted at #1. "Scary Movie 4" is still tickling funny bones at #5 and "Ice Age" remains on the chart even after it's 5th week with a total box-office gross of $177,708,000.
  1. RV       $16,400,000
  2. United 93       $11,605,000   Reviews
  3. Stick It        $11,255,000     Review
  4. Silent Hill        $9,300,000    Reviews
  5. Scary Movie 4        $7,808,000    Review
  6. The Sentinel        $7,600,000   Reviews
  7. Ice Age       $7,050,000    Review
  8. Akeelah and the Bee       $6,250,000
  9. The Wild        $4,719,000        Review
  10. The Benchwarmers      $4,400,000     Review
Next week promises to be a Tom Cruise weekend as "Mission Impossible 3" hits the big screen. If audiences are still in the mood for horror they will have "American Haunting" to scream about. And Disney's "Hoot" may attract younger audiences but I will be staying clear. If this week is any indication, I would suspect that it's possible that more people will warm up to seeing "United 93" by next weekend, keeping it somewhere high on the charts. And while "Mission Impossible" will surely dethrown RV I'm sure Robin Williams will continue to rake in quite a bit in the box-office come next weekend as well.
